Dividend of NT$3.00 announced Dividend of NT$3.00 is the same as last year. Ex-date: 3rd July 2025 Payment date: 23rd July 2025 Dividend yield will be 6.0%, which is higher than the industry average of 4.0%. Sustainability & Growth Dividend is not adequately covered by earnings (92% earnings payout ratio) nor is it covered by cash flows (122% cash payout ratio). The dividend has decreased over the past 10 years, but has still been somewhat stable with no excessively large reductions to payments. The company's earnings per share (EPS) would need to grow by 1.9% to bring the payout ratio under control. However, EPS has declined by 4.4% over the last 5 years so the company would need to reverse this trend. Reported Earnings • May 15

Dividend of NT$3.00 announced Shareholders will receive a dividend of NT$3.00. Ex-date: 4th July 2024 Payment date: 24th July 2024 Dividend yield will be 5.6%, which is higher than the industry average of 4.0%. Sustainability & Growth Dividend is covered by earnings (90.0% earnings payout ratio) but not covered by cash flows (130% cash payout ratio). The dividend has decreased over the past 10 years, indicating a lack of growth and stability in payments. Earnings per share declined by 3.4% over the last 5 years, which if continued should see the payout ratio increase to a potentially unsustainable range. Duyuru • Jun 19
